UNC ranks as No. 1 best value public for 21st straight year
Posted Sep 23, 2025
UNC-Chapel Hill delivers both excellence and affordability. Ranked No. 4 among public universities and No. 1 for best value among public institutions in the 2026 U.S. News & World Report Best Colleges rankings, Carolina has been ranked among the top 5 public universities for 24 consecutive years and a best value among public universities for 21 years.
